AUDITION NOTICE – ‘The Birds and the Bees’ by Mark Crawford

AUDITION NOTICE
The Birds and the Bees, by Mark Crawford
Directed by Francesca Brugnano / Produced by Michelle Spanik

Newly divorced Sarah has moved back home to live with her mom, Gail. But Gail has other things on her mind; why do her honeybees keep dying, what’s the deal with her flirtatious neighbour Earl, and what’s the secret that Ben, the studious Masters student, is hiding? This comedy examines all types of relationships and will leave you with a full heart.

CAST REQUIRED
SARAH: F – 30s-40s, a recently separated turkey farmer whose life has been turned upside-down. She is Gail’s daughter.
GAIL: F – 50s-60s, a prudish bee-keeper who has been “stuck” since her divorce, 20 years ago. She is Sarah’s mother.
EARL: M – 50s-60s, a farmer and Gail’s neighbour. He’s crusty on the outside, but he’s always there when you need him.
BEN: M – 20s-30s, an idealistic university student who is studying Gail’s bees. He is naive, energetic, and kind
